3. The patient navigator can help cancer patients navigate the maze of health care options, potentially increasing survival rates.

Impact of Screening and Patient Navigation on Breast Cancer 5-year Survival Rates - Harlem Hospital Center - This table shows that the five year survival rate before access to screening and patient navigation (1964-1986) was 39%, compared to a 70% five year survival rate after access to screening and patient navigation (1995-2000).
